Strategic Font Pairing for Enhanced Impact
While Brogman is powerful on its own, combining it with other typefaces can elevate a design from good to great. As a versatile modern typography tool, it pairs well with several different styles:
- Clean Sans Serif Fonts: Pairing Brogman with another geometric sans serif can create a monochromatic, ultra-modern look. This is effective for tech startups or SaaS companies aiming for a sleek, corporate identity.
- Elegant Serif Fonts: Combining the minimalism of Brogman with a classic serif font creates a striking juxtaposition. Use Brogman for headers and a serif font for body text to add a touch of tradition and trustworthiness. This combination works wonderfully for editorial design, luxury packaging design, and high-end blog layouts.
- Script or Handwritten Fonts: To add a human touch, pair Brogman with a delicate script font. The structured nature of Brogman grounds the whimsical elements of the script, preventing the design from becoming chaotic. This is perfect for personal brands, creative agencies, or seasonal greeting campaigns.
Technical Considerations for Commercial Use
Before integrating Brogman into client campaigns or branded content, it is essential to review the technical specifications. A robust font file should include multiple weights, italics, and potentially alternates or ligatures that add character without compromising cleanliness. Check if the font supports multilingual characters if your audience is global; missing accented letters can break the flow of international marketing materials.
Furthermore, always verify the commercial font licensing terms. Ensure that the license covers all intended uses, including digital ads, merchandise, and client work. Understanding the file formats available (such as OTF, TTF, or WOFF) ensures compatibility with various design software and web development environments.
